Simple Circumference Calculator: Formula and Examples
Calculating the perimeter of a circle, known as its circumference, is relatively straightforward using a simple equation . The key formula is C = 2πr, where ‘C’ stands for the circumference, π (pi) is a mathematical value approximately equal to 3.14159, and ‘r’ indicates the radius of the circle. For illustration, if a circle has a radius of 5 inches, then its circumference would be 2 * 3.14159 * 5 = approximately 31.4159 inches. Alternatively, if you are given the diameter (d), which is twice the radius, you can use the formula C = πd. So, if the diameter is 10 centimeters , the circumference becomes 3.14159 * 10 = approximately 31.4159 inches. This method provides a quick and effortless way to determine the circumference of any circle.
